Output 88d61aab174627bb34925da475ccd090f8afb1d65cf085970e64d22a9f57504f:1

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d2ea9c176821cb00a5a4bd6bde88043b1795ab6 OP_EQUAL
address
34MKRKJkSHMjTsVut6uuXE9SYTL1dBGc2A
transaction
88d61aab174627bb34925da475ccd090f8afb1d65cf085970e64d22a9f57504f
confirmations
352405
spent
true